The Arabs are anation that has long been known to be succeeded in influencing other nations. It is, among others, proven by the wide-spread of Islam through a variety of ways, i.e. politic, tasawwuf, trade, or marriage, although later trade is considered as the most dominant step that allegedly committed by Arabs.Geographically, Semarang and Surakarta are two cities located differently, Semarang is located on the north coast of Java, while Surakarta is located in the mainland. Both have a long history in the development of Islam in Java. In Semarang as well as Surakarta, could be found the Arabs community. This paper tries to discuss from where and when the Arabs came to both cities as well as their first purpose at their arrival.
